![](https://img-blog.csdnimg.cn/053ce1ab216e4b34bef3c87b502f484e.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
单片机
文章平均质量分 80
STM32,K60等,甚至画一些简单的PCB
本科其实基本都在搞这些了,看看有没有时间把之前的资料整理一下发出来当回忆了
qqsuiying
这个作者很懒,什么都没留下…
展开
-
python收发can采坑总结 (jetson xavier)
项目原因需要使用python进行can的收发,将操作进行记录之前在stm32和k60上用C收发过can,本来以为会很顺利,然而还是踩了很多坑测试设备:天准xavier Ubuntu18.04 python3.6先给一个比较官方的链接(python_can)SocketCAN — python-can 4.0.0 documentation天准官方也给出了比较详细的命令行测试命令1. 采坑1 :循环发送的话会导致buffer问题Traceback原创 2022-05-30 21:00:49 · 2689 阅读 · 4 评论 -
基于形态学的图像处理
一、实验原理、目的与要求、实验原理、目的与要求要求:从带有车道线的图像(图2)中检测出车道线,并将检测算法通过摄像头采集实现实时的车道线检测。检测算法包括(但不限)以下步骤:读入图像; 灰度变换; 去噪; 边缘检测; 线检测(直线/曲线); 视频采集及实时检测 图3-1 原图原理: 形态学处理:开运算:先腐蚀后膨胀的过程。用来消除小物体、在纤细点处分离物体、平滑较大物体的边界的同时并不明显改变其面积。开运算通常是在需要去除小颗粒噪声,以及断开目标物之间粘连时使用。.原创 2021-01-22 00:00:21 · 1481 阅读 · 3 评论 -
使用华为modelarts进行车辆识别
要求:从图像(图3)中检测并识别出车辆。车辆检测和识别算法可采用深度学习、BP网络或特征匹配等方法,方法不限。图5-1待识别图像原理:ModelArts是面向AI开发者的一站式开发平台,支持自动学习的功能,还预置了多种已训练好的模型,ModelArts相对而言降低了AI应用的门槛,是一个高灵活、零代码的定制化模型开发工具,平台根据标注数据自动设计模型、自动调参、自动训练、自动压缩和部署模型。本次实验使用自动学习中的物体检测功能,用于识别图片中车的数量和位置。其简要流程图如下图5-2自动学原创 2021-01-21 23:49:21 · 1662 阅读 · 0 评论 -
针对智能车声标组的声音定位方案研究
图4.11 值的变化情况下面利用matlab定量绘制某一方向的值,由曲线可知在距离相对较远时无限趋近某一常数,如下图所示,而今年灯壳的半径加上车身已超过30cm,是满足音源相对较远这一条件。因此可以用唯一确定音源角度。 分别记两组对角线上麦克风的距离差为距离差1和距离差2,通过matlab仿真可以进行论证,两组对角线麦克风的距离差的差(以下简称为距离差的差)在距离相对较远时无限趋近某一常数,该常数随着角度变化而发生改变,如下图。由于今年新版信标灯的灯壳半径加上车身已超过30cm,...原创 2021-01-18 11:37:21 · 3773 阅读 · 1 评论 -
简单地用状态机写的按键检测
在CSDN上写的第一篇文章,,,,之前就听说过状态机,但并没有感觉到其比普通按键的优越之处。接触了实时操作系统之后,才领悟到这种按键检测方法可以很好地利用CPU的资源(或者说不用实时操作系统时更体现优越性)这里直接粘贴按键检测的代码了(按键、LED初始化、UCOS系统就不赘述了)程序是STM32F103的,不过和芯片类型关系不大void key0_task(void *pdata){while(...原创 2018-07-10 19:29:15 · 1457 阅读 · 0 评论